原创 angr path in symblic execution
bu neng da pin yin , hao qi ida cfg : type python : irsb = proj.factory.block(addr=addr_main).vex main_state
原创 利用ida python 實現復原函數調用的參數 (僅對數據被簡單硬編碼有效)
例如我們有一個 c 源程序 /************************************************************************* > File Name: ddg.c > Auth
原创 IDAPython 編程之 查找相鄰指令
# a IDAPython script : give two instruction close to each other like move add , it find their binary representation
原创 (逆向)angr 執行二進制函數
關於angr: github 搜索angr 首先編譯源碼: #include<stdio.h> unsigned int ORHash(char *str , int len){ int i = 0 ; unsig
原创 IDA python 腳本編程使用參考資料鏈接
Alphabetical list of IDC functions IDA python IDC
原创 ubuntu16.04 64bit 安裝 ida
由於IDA這款軟件是32bit的軟件,所以64位系統需要首先安裝32bit支持 sudo apt-get install libc6:i386 sudo apt-get install lib32stdc++6 sudo apt-
原创 simuvex 符號分析形象解釋
https://archive.fosdem.org/2014/schedule/event/valgrind_simuvex/attachments/slides/510/export/events/attachments/valgri